数电笔记(三)自上而下理解优先编码器

如题所述

层次化设计与模块化设计是数字系统设计中的两种关键策略。层次化设计意味着自顶向下或自底向上的分解任务,使每一层复杂度降低,模块功能简化。模块化设计则是将经过设计与验证、具有特定逻辑功能的电路封装为模块,以便在后续设计中重复使用。通过这种分层和模块化方法,未来工作量得以减轻。

编码器是数字系统中用于将输入的高低电平信号转换为对应的二进制代码的模块。在编码过程中,一系列不同的事物通过其独一无二的二进制代码进行区分。编码器能够接收一系列输入信号,并将其转换为相应的二进制代码。以二进制普通编码器为例,其真值表显示了如何将八个高电平信号转换为三个二进制代码。然而,普通编码器只能允许同时存在一个高电平信号,对于输入信号的组合处理存在局限性。

为了解决普通编码器的局限性,我们引入了优先编码器的概念。优先编码器允许多个输入信号同时存在,但具有不同的优先级。当一个更高优先级的信号出现时,它将优先被编码,而其他较低优先级的信号将被忽略。在设计中,我们通过设置不同输入端的优先级,实现了对输入信号的有效控制,从而能够输出正确且具有优先级排序的编码结果。

客户提出了更高需求:设计一个16线-4线优先编码器。在满足稳定性要求的前提下,我们选择使用低电平有效的方式。通过增加一个输入开关和输出端,我们可以实现对两块8线优先编码器的控制,从而构建16线-4线的编码器。通过合理设计控制逻辑,确保编码器的优先级顺序和有效输入方式,我们能够实现模块化设计中的关键步骤。

在解决优先编码器的设计问题后,我们成功构建了一个通用的8线-3线优先编码器模块。通过连接多个这样的模块,我们能够应对更复杂的设计需求。剩下的工作则在于如何具体连接这些模块以满足特定的系统要求。这不仅涉及到对模块的连接,还要求设计者深入理解层次化和模块化设计原则,以及如何在实践中应用这些原则。
温馨提示:内容为网友见解,仅供参考
无其他回答

数电笔记(三)自上而下理解优先编码器
客户提出了更高需求:设计一个16线-4线优先编码器。在满足稳定性要求的前提下,我们选择使用低电平有效的方式。通过增加一个输入开关和输出端,我们可以实现对两块8线优先编码器的控制,从而构建16线-4线的编码器。通过合理设计控制逻辑,确保编码器的优先级顺序和有效输入方式,我们能够实现模块化设计中...

数字电子优先编码器题目:优先编码器输入为。。。,(优先级别最高),输 ...
数字电子优先编码器是一种能接收多个输入信号,根据输入信号的优先级进行编码的设备。一般情况下,优先级较高的输入信号会被编码器首先处理。我无法看到具体的题目,所以假设题目中给定的是一个4位二进制数的优先编码器,它接收四个输入信号 A, B, C, D,对应的二进制编码为 000A,000B,001C,010...

数电(二)常用芯片汇总及典型应用
期末复习数电知识时,我们来梳理一些常用的芯片及其典型应用。首先,了解编码器,分为普通和优先两种类型。普通编码器如8-3线的74HC148,用于单次编码,输入8位二进制,输出3位编码。优先编码器如148级联的32-5线,可同时处理多个信号,按优先级编码。编码器中涉及真值表和逻辑表达式的转换,以及控制端...

数电 数字电子技术 期末考试常用芯片功能总结
DigitalFundamentals数电数字电子技术考试常用芯片功能总结Slide174LS148(优先编码器)Logicsymbolforthe74LS1488-line-to-3lineencoder.Slide274LS148(优先编码器)英文版芯片功能表输入输出EI01234567A2A1A0GSEO1XXXXXXXX11111011111111111100XXXXXXX0000010XXXXXX01001010XXXXX011010010XXXX0111011010XXX0111110001LXX01111110...

一道数电选择题 谢谢 具有“有0出1,全1出0”功能的逻辑门是 与非门...
A、74LS48 (4线-七段译码器) B、74LS148(8线-3线优先编码器)C、74LS138 (3线-8线译码器) D、74LS147 (10线-4线优先编码器)E、74ls03(四组2输入与非门)选 E 74ls03(四组2输入与非门)

用数电知识将7位二进制数以十进制形式显示在两个数码管上,应该怎么做...
你要用两个个2-10进制译码器(注意级联),然后用七段数码管译码器连接LED管。可以先用软件仿真。芯片用74LS148(优先编码器,实现BCD编码的转换)+CD4511(七段译码器,驱动数码管)

码制|| BCD码 || 格雷码 || 奇偶校验码 || 字母数字码 || 数电
BCD码包括8421码、54221码、2421码以及余三码等,其中8421码、5421码、2421码为有权码,余三码为无权码,基于8421码加上二进制数0011得到。格雷码则是一种位无权码,相邻两个代码之间仅有一位不同,其余各位均相同。它在相邻值转换时能有效减少错误,通常用于编码器和数字调制。二进制码与格雷码的...

大学中的数电是什么内容
大二上,正在学,数字电路与系统设计基础,大概分了这几个部分,第一部分对逻辑数值的理解与转换,通俗地讲就是一大堆0100010111,化简找规律。第二部分,组合逻辑,这部分介绍了很多芯片,要求你会用这些芯片组合完成你想要的效果,最简单的输入0输出1.第三部分,触发器,这部分告诉你,电路是有延迟的...

期末考试如何复习数电?
2、反相器饱和、截止判断 二、基本门电路及其逻辑符号 与门、或非门、非门、与非门、OC门、三态门、异或; 传输门、OC\/OD门及三态门的应用 三、门电路的外特性 1、输入端电阻特性:对TTL门电路而言,输入端通过电阻接地或低电平时,由于输入电流流过该电阻,会在电阻上产生压降,当电阻大于开门电阻...

编码 解码的作用 电子领域
只能简单地说一下。模拟信号通过AD转为数字信号。数字信号一般用二进制表示。然后对这个进行编码(一般称为基带数字信号)。编码一般有三种:信源编码,也就是对数据进行压缩。信道编码,也称为纠错编码,这是为了保证数据的质量。加密编码。这个大家都知道。这些进行完了才谈得上调制。另一端的过程与之...

相似回答
大家正在搜